Structure and Content MasterFormat organizes information into a two-level numeric hierarchy: Divisions (two-digit major groups) and Section numbers (six-digit or six-character section IDs, where the first two digits indicate the division). Each section has a standardized title. For example, Division 03 is Concrete, and section numbers in that division start with “03.” The 50-division structure includes broad groups such as General Requirements (Division 01), Facility Construction (Divisions 02–14), Facility Services (Divisions 20–29), Site and Infrastructure (Divisions 30–39), and Process Equipment (Divisions 40–49). The official list of numbers and titles is available for purchase and download through the Construction Specifications Institute (CSI) Store . While the full standard is proprietary, CSI provides a Transition Matrix in Excel format to purchasers, which allows users to map numbers and titles between the 1995, 2018, and 2020 editions.
